[QUOTE="CL82, post: 2795724, member: 44"] [I]5. UCONN Best player: Jalen Adams, who Dan Hurley wants (needs) to live up to that moniker every day in practice and in games. Best newcomers: [URL='https://www.nhregister.com/sports/article/Dan-Hurley-lands-first-UConn-commitment-12835682.php']Brendan Adams, a freshman [/URL]and brother of Jaylen (not Jalen), and A-10 Sixth Man of the Year [URL='https://www.nhregister.com/sports/article/Dan-Hurley-lands-first-UConn-commitment-12835682.php']Tarin Smith, a grad transfer from Duquesne[/URL] who played for Hurley’s dad, Bob, at St. Anthony’s. Biggest loss: Terry Larrier Biggest question mark: Can Alterique Gilbert, after missing nearly all the past two seasons with shoulder woes, remain healthy? That’s the key to it all. Hurley’s already turned around two other programs, and he’s got the talent here to do it again. Jalen Adams is the league’s best player. Alterique Gilbert could be AAC preseason Rookie of the Year a third straight season. Christian Vital averaged nearly 15 per game last season. But there are question marks galore. Can Gilbert finally stay healthy? Can Adams be the best player on the court every night? Can a big man or two (Josh Carlton? Eric Cobb?) step up? Will a team dogged by bad habits and questionable poor work ethic the past couple of years buy into Hurley’s no-nonsense, high-energy style? (It’s telling that not a single player transferred after Hurley replaced Kevin Ollie). [/I] [/QUOTE]
